I liked it. I thought the atmosphere was well done, especially in the first half of the level . I enjoyed the devil dogs and other creatures as well. I did have some moments where I would try to jump on a dog or creature and get stuck in between the ruins in the background, but it wasn't too bad. Oh! I also liked one section where I died and was greeted with a new challenge back at the respond point that wasn't there before. Do you do that elsewhere in the level? I thought that was pretty ingenious and would be a nice way of keeping sections where you die interesting.

The multiple boss fights were pretty cool as well, but after the first two, the snake felt a bit lame. Also, the atmosphere felt a bit different to me here. Specifically, after the mine cart ride (which looked awesome by the way), the level seemed to be less detailed as it was in the first half.

You've got a good level here. Continue to tweak it, perhaps add some more detail at the end, reduce the chance of getting stuck in rubble during jumps, etc. Good job!

OK, here are some thoughts on the level:

I have to begin by saying this looks completely different from the level I tested about a week ago. You completely changed the lighting (maybe that was always your intention but was not in place when I played it) and the level looks 10X better ( I thought it looked great to begin with).

Your use of lighting in this level is simply incredible. There were a couple of sections where I literally stopped playing just to admire the beautiful lighting. Truly one of the most impressive uses of light I have ever seen in LBP.

Your devil dogs are one of the coolest enemies I have fought in LBP. They are tiny but boy are they deadly lol. You compensated for some of the easy deaths caused by these little guys by adding infinite checkpoints so I really can't complain.

Speaking of checkpoints, I love the totem poles you have bordering them. This was a very artistic touch that still perfectly fits the atmosphere of your level. Well done man, they were truly beautiful to look at.

I really liked the way you imbedded fire into your structures. I don't believe I have ever seen it done to the extent that you did it and it really reinforced the idea of being in hell. You also have some wonderful statues/structures in the background throughout the level that really add some visual punch.

I liked that at various sections you had some really great looking falling debris, it added some variety to the level.

I liked the glass slide. Nothing particularly original here but for some reason I really enjoyed this one.

You have 3 boss battles! To be fair none of them are really challenging but I don't really mind. The fact is that all three are very different from eachother and the boss' are completely original. My favorite is the second or "main" boss. That hammer of his looks rather deady and man is it big lol. I loved scaling his back and tearing off that horn, well done.

Suggestions:

- The paintinator is used on the first boss but I am not so sure the paintinator fits the theme of your level. It is much easier then the blockes you originaly had but maybe you could come up with something else? (maybe create a weapon for the player to use for example)

- During the section with the glass floor and fire ceiling. There were some stickers that I felt did nit fit the overall atmosphere you had going on. Just a personal opinion.

- The grabbable spinning wheels have been done to death. I think spinning wheels are nice but it would not hurt to somehow make them different from the generic spinning wheels we see all the time (or you could completely revamp this section and add something else).

- Color your checkpoints.

That's pretty much it. I honestly don't think the level is incomplete. Like all levels, there will always be things you can change/improve upon post-publishing but as far as I'm concerned this level is more the ready for "deployment" lol.
